Houston Rockets Dominate Wizards with Explosive Third Quarter

Jalen Green's 22-point third quarter powers Rockets to a 135-112 victory over the short-handed Washington Wizards.

  • Jalen Green scored 22 of his game-high 29 points in the third quarter, leading a dominant 40-point period for the Houston Rockets.
  • Alperen Sengun contributed 26 points, 10 rebounds, and 6 assists, while Amen Thompson recorded a double-double with 20 points and 15 rebounds.
  • The Rockets capitalized on 18 Wizards turnovers, converting them into 35 points, the most Washington has allowed from turnovers this season.
  • Washington's leading scorer Jordan Poole missed his second consecutive game due to a hip injury, and Kyle Kuzma exited at halftime with a calf contusion.
  • The Rockets improved to 6-1 on the road against Eastern Conference teams, while the Wizards suffered their third straight loss.
